MILAN EXPRESS CO., INC.
TARIFF 19 0 -A
ITEM 110
The terms:
DEFINITIONS AND EXPLANATIONS OF TERMS
1. "BUSINESS DAY" means each day, Monday thru Friday, excluding Holidays.
2. "BUSINESS HOURS" means those hours which the community or trade involved generally keep their facilities open to all concerned.
3. "CARRIER", "CONSIGNOR" or "CONSIGNEE" include the authorized representatives or agents of such
"carrier", "consignor" or "consignee".
4. "CONSIGNEE TO UNLOAD THE SHIPMENT" means that the consignee will perform the complete service of unloading the freight from the position in which it was transported in or on the carrier'svehicle.
5. "CONSIGNOR TO LOAD THE SHIPMENT" means the consignor will perform the complete service of loading the freight in or on the carrier's vehicle and the proper stowing and/or stacking thereof to withstand normal hazards of transportation. When blocking or bracing is necessary to insure safe transportation, such blocking or bracing must be furnished and installed by and at the expense of the consignor.
6. "HOLIDAY" means: New Years Day, Memorial Day, Independence Day, Labor Day, Thanksgiving Day and the day after, Christmas Eve Day, Christmas Day, or any other day generally observed as a holiday by the carrier at the point where the service is performed. When such holidays fall on a Sunday, the following Monday will be considered as a holiday.
7. "JOINT-LINE TRAFFIC" means the transportation of a shipment via two or more motor carriers, not including carriers performing pickup service at a point of origin or delivery service at point of destination intermediate interchange point as agent of the originating or delivering carriers.
8. "MLXP" means: Milan Express Company, Incorporated.
9. "PLACE" (See NOTE A), means a particular street address or other designation of a factory, store, warehouse place of business or private residence at a "point". The "place" shall include only contiguous property which shall not be deemed separate if intersected by a public street or thoroughfare.
10."POINT" means a particular city, town, village, community or other area which is treated as a unit for the application of line-haul rates.
11."SINGLE LINE TRAFFIC" means the transportation of a shipment via one carrier or via two or more motor carriers specifically designated as being considered as one carrier, whether pickup service at point of origin or delivery service at point of destination is performed by the carrier or for its account by another carrier as its agent.
12."SITE" means a particular platform or specific location for loading or unloading at a "place".
13."TRAFFIC HANDLED DIRECT" means the transportation of a shipment via only one motor carrier (not including carriers specifically designated as being considered as one carrier), whether pickup service at point of origin or delivery service at point of destination is performed by such carrier or for its account by another carrier as its agent.
14."TRUCK" or "VEHICLE" means any vehicle or vehicles propelled or drawn by a single mechanical powerunit and used on the highways in the transportation of property.
15."TWO-LINE HAUL", "THREE-LINE HAUL" or "FOUR-LINE HAUL" includes the carrier for whose account the provisions are published. Unless otherwise specifically provided, two or more carriers specifically designated as being considered as one carrier will be considered as only one line.
16. "ANY QUANTITY (AQ)"--An AQ rate or rating is one which is specifically designated AQ in this tariff or in tariffs making reference to this tariff and are those applicable to the articles regardless of the quantity or weight of the shipment.
17. "CONVERTA-VAN" means a trailer that can be used as a flatbed by removing side panels.
18. "LESS THAN TRUCKLOAD (LTL)"--A quantity of freight less than TL.
19. "VOLUME OR TRUCKLOAD (VOL or TL)"--A quantity of freight specifically designated TL or VOL or a quantity of freight for which a TL or VOL minimum weight is specifically provided.
20. "TIR CARNET" means a document used to expedite the movement of goods in international trade and it guarantees the custom duties, if any.
